Solar requires 10 energy storage
To match a 5 kW solar system, you need around 10 kWh of battery storage. Choose between lithium-ion batteries, which allow 80% depth of discharge (DoD), and lead-acid batteries, which offer 50% to 80% DoD. . Battery sizing is goal-driven: Emergency backup requires 10-20 kWh, bill optimization needs 20-40 kWh, while energy independence demands 50+ kWh. How many solar panels are there for 10 kilowatts
A 10kW solar system typically requires 25–34 panels, depending on panel wattage. Key factors include solar irradiance, panel efficiency (18%–22% for monocrystalline), and daily sun. . Example: For a 10 kW solar system, you can use 33 300-watt PV panels (9900 watts) + 1 100-watt solar panel to bring the total up to 10,000 watts or 10kW solar system. How much does 10 kilowatts of solar glass cost
On average, a 10 kW solar panel system costs $25,400, according to real-world quotes on the EnergySage Marketplace from 2025 data. But your actual price will depend on factors like your roof's complexity, local labor costs, the equipment you choose, and what incentives are available in your area.
